Demystifying Car Dealer Auction Procedures
Navigating the world of car dealer auctions can seem intimidating for the uninitiated. However, understanding the basic mechanics involved can empower you to confidently participate and potentially acquire a great deal on your next vehicle.
Auctions typically involve a structured process where dealers compete for vehicles comprising from used cars to fleet disposals. Before you attend an auction, it's crucial to research the specific rules and regulations of the dealership or auction house. This includes understanding the sign-up process, acceptable payment methods, and any requirements on vehicle inspections.
Once registered, you'll have the opportunity to browse the available vehicles on display. Many auctions provide detailed specifications about each car, including its condition. It's recommended to thoroughly inspect any vehicle that catches your interest before placing a bid.
Remember, successful bidding at an auction requires careful evaluation of the vehicle's value and your personal budget. Set a maximum bid limit for yourself beforehand and maintain to it, avoiding emotional decisions driven by the momentum of the bidding process.
